Beskrivelse av kunstverket

The artwork Three Figures by William Brice, created in 1961, is a captivating oil on canvas piece that showcases the artist's unique style and technique. Measuring 36 x 46 cm, this painting is a representation of three naked individuals on a beach, each facing away from the others. The setting includes a rocky outcropping and sand, with a cloudy blue sky in the background.

Artistic Style and Influences

William Brice's work is characterized by his use of bold colors and abstract forms. In Three Figures, he employs a more subdued color palette, focusing on earthy tones to convey a sense of serenity and intimacy. The painting's composition, with the three figures positioned in a triangular formation, creates a sense of balance and harmony. Key Features:
  • The use of oil on canvas as the medium, which allows for rich textures and vibrant colors
  • The depiction of the human form in a natural setting, emphasizing the connection between nature and humanity
  • The artist's unique brushwork and technique, which adds to the painting's emotional depth and expressiveness

Conservation and Exhibition

Three Figures is part of the collection at the Hirshhorn Museum and Sculpture Garden in the United States. This museum is renowned for its extensive collection of modern and contemporary art, featuring works by artists such as William Brice. William Brice: Echoes of Antiquity and the Quiet Power of Abstraction

William Brice (April 23, 1921 – March 3, 2008) was an American artist whose distinctive style—characterized by monumental canvases populated with stylized masses reminiscent of ancient ruins—established him as a pivotal figure in late modernist painting. Born to actress Fanny Brice and professional gambler Julius W. “Nicky” Arnstein, his early life was marked by instability and exposure to artistic luminaries like Clifford Odets and the Gershwin brothers, fostering an environment that nurtured his burgeoning talent. From childhood, Brice benefited from private art instruction, shaping him into a disciplined artist with a profound understanding of draughtsmanship. Influenced deeply by Henri Matisse and Pablo Picasso—whom he acquired a print of at the age of fourteen—Brice’s artistic journey began in earnest at Chouinard Art Institute (1937–39, 1940–42) and continued with studies at the Art Students League of New York (1939–40). His debut solo exhibition at the Santa Barbara Museum of Art in 1947 showcased his initial explorations into figuration and representation, demonstrating a sensitivity to form and detail. Critiques from publications like *The Los Angeles Times* noted the geometric emphasis within his still lifes—a stylistic choice that foreshadowed his later embrace of abstraction. Moving away from the dominant currents of Abstract Expressionism and Action Painting, Brice championed a more restrained aesthetic, prioritizing meticulous technique and compositional balance. He sought to distill complex ideas into simplified shapes, creating canvases that conveyed emotion without resorting to overt gesture or dramatic color palettes. This approach—often described as “classic modernism”—became his hallmark, particularly evident in his prolific output from 1948 until 1952 when he taught at the Jepson Art Institute and subsequently served as a professor at UCLA until his retirement in 1991. During this period, he mentored generations of artists, imparting invaluable knowledge about European modernism and fostering a connection to artistic traditions spanning centuries. Brice’s enduring legacy resides not only in his impressive body of work but also in his role as an educator—inspiring countless students to pursue their own creative endeavors. His monumental canvases—such as ‘Interior II,’ currently housed at the Hirshhorn Museum—continue to captivate viewers with their evocative imagery and masterful execution. Furthermore, his fascination with Greek antiquity—documented during a significant trip in 1970—served as a crucial catalyst for his artistic vision, informing the recurring motifs of ruined temples and monumental forms that define his distinctive oeuvre.
